The genomic DNA of the B
E
strain of
Escherichia coli
has been scrutinized to detect porin genes that have not been identified so far. Southern blot analysis yielded two DNA segments which proved highly homologous to, yet distinct from, the
ompC
,
ompF
, and
phoE
porin genes. The two genes were cloned and sequenced. One of them, designated
ompN
, encodes a porin which, due to low levels of expression, has eluded prior identification. The functional properties (single-channel conductance) of the OmpN porin, purified to homogeneity, closely resemble those of the OmpC porin from
E. coli
K-12. The second DNA fragment detected corresponds to the
nmpC
gene, which, due to an insertion of an IS
1
element in its coding region, is not expressed in
E. coli
B
E
.
